What We Do:

Nuclear Weapons Security (NWS) is an engineering development and sustainment business. Currently in the seventh year of being a sole source prime, we are a system integrator and sustainer of Commercial Off The Shelf (COTS) physical security hardware and software for mission critical high assurance environments. While NWS is primarily a "people" business with no products on the market right now, we are working to fill a key gap in the security industry with the internal R&D project. Quorum.

Working with Engineering, Operations Support and individuals in other departments, the Advanced Engineering Technician will support engineering activities such as design, test, check-out, modification, fabrication and assembly of prototype electro mechanical systems, experimental design circuitry, laser/light transmission devices or specialized test equipment. This may entail performing the following:

  • Interprets basic engineering drawings, diagrams and schematics
  • Constructs, modifies, debugs, troubleshoots, calibrates, tests and adjusts a variety of tools, equipment and systems
  • Conducts, analyzes and documents statistically based experiments to define process parameters
  • Implements and documents complex solutions for process improvement
  • Designs and constructs basic tooling and fixtures to accomplish unique tasks
  • Organizes, analyzes and interprets data to identify cause/effect relationships and recommends resolution/process improvement

Duties and Task:

  • On-cal and call-in status is required after normal working hours, on weekends and holidays on rotating basis.
  • Qualify NWS Electronic Security System Technician within 3 months of hire, to perform minor preventive and corrective maintenance indoors and outdoors on sensors, cameras and active vehicle barriers.
  • Qualify Cyber Security Workforce (CSWF), and System Administrator to perform minor preventive and corrective maintenance on network systems to include AC&D system in secure areas.
  • Some travel may be required
